基于以太网和现场总线的控制系统通信设计

摘  要:针对管材连续热处理装置由多台单体设备和操作台组成、且单体设备即可以独立操作,又可以联动操作,单体设备或操作台之间需要进行数据通信的实际情况,结合集散控制系统结构特点,简单介绍了管材连续热处理装置控制系统的配置、结构,设计了控制系统的通信网络,详细的介绍通信系统的硬件配置、组态和软件编程;设备投运后,控制系统运行平稳、可靠。Pipe continuous heat treatment equipment is composed of many sets of equipment and working stations, and the single equipment can be operation independently, or can be combined operation, the equipments or the working stations need for data communication among work stations.
